A HANDSOME PRIZE.
- -•- The tablet presented by Mr Gosling to the Horticultural Show, as a prize for the best collection of pot plants, is a beautiful work of art. A scriptural in« cription is supported on each side with well executed drawings of New Zealand ferns, and at the foot is represented a group of flowers hanging in festoons. The other parts are filled in with magnificently colored bunches of flowers. We congratulate Mr Gosling on his artistic taste and ability, and consider the prizetaker will be doubly fortunate in winning so charming an ornament. Mr Eade has it in hand for framing, and his workmanship will considerauly enhance its value as a prize.
